Welcome to the seventh day of our Christmas challenge where today we watched a film based on a famous day in America which occurs on the 4TH of July which is called Independence day, however it gets interrupted by aliens that bring chaos to Earth. Our favourite actor plays a pilot that bravely serves his country by flying a Warcraft and how he and others around the world fight back to save Earth before it is destroyed into ruin. This review has been given a four star rating which means we like it because of the action but we disliked the aliens as they look ugly and scary. I would recommend this film for people aged 12 or over because of naughty words and the fright of the aliens appearance.
